Am Samstag, den 17.05.2008, 23:43 +0200 schrieb Andreas Tille: > On Sat, 17 May 2008, Charles Plessy wrote: > > > since it makes complete sense I propose the followign addition to our > > policy: > > I also perfectly agree and I might have missed something in the quilt docs > but this aspect seems to be better solved in dpatch. While I consider > quilt as much easier to use I really liked the way dpatch handled comments > inside the patch file. Is there anything comparable in quilt?
You can put some comments and notes at the top (before the Index: line). I saw this in another package and it works. You should further add a good description of the patch to debian/changelog. This is the first place one will take a look and it would be good to have a description there too (my personal opinion).
